Laser welding machines are one of the most crucial equipment in today's industrial sector, widely used on production lines in industries such as automotive, electronics, and new energy. If laser welding machines are not maintained and serviced according to regulations, it can lead to a decline in equipment performance, affecting their efficiency and lifespan.
Maintenance and care for laser welding machines primarily includes the following aspects:
Regular equipment cleaning
Dust and debris can accumulate during equipment operation, which can affect the output power and efficiency of the laser, as well as accelerate equipment wear. Therefore, regular cleaning of the equipment is essential. When cleaning, it's important to avoid using cleaners with chemical ingredients to prevent damage to the equipment.
2. Inspect Equipment Guards
The device cover protects the internal laser generator and other critical components from dust and other debris. Therefore, inspecting and cleaning the device cover is an important aspect of equipment maintenance. If the cover is damaged, it should be replaced promptly.
3. Regular replacement of consumables
The lifespan of laser welding machines is relatively long; however, certain components with shorter lifespans, such as laser pump, mirrors, and filters, need to be regularly replaced. These components generally have a defined lifespan, and beyond that point, they can negatively impact the machine's performance. Therefore, it's crucial to regularly check the condition of these parts and replace them as needed when using a laser welding machine.
4. Regular equipment calibration
Laser welding machines are high-precision equipment that require regular calibration to ensure their working accuracy and stability. Calibration involves adjusting the equipment's position and angle, laser power, zero-point error, etc., which can be done through instruments or by the manufacturer or professionals.
In summary, proper maintenance is crucial for laser welding machines to ensure normal operation and extend their lifespan. When using the equipment, operators should adhere to correct procedures to avoid excessive damage. Additionally, regular maintenance and upkeep should be performed to ensure the machine's performance and stability.
